Addaction
Telephone: 020 7251 5860 Website: www.addaction.org.uk
For many problem drug and alcohol users addressing their addiction is just one step on a long road to recovery. Many face a host of other difficulties in their lives be it a lack of qualifications, poor communication skills or no work experience. This will often be combined with a lack of confidence and self-esteem as well as physical and mental health problems. Without additional support this can cause significant obstacles in their path to becoming active members of society and finding employment.

Narcotics Anonymous
Telephone: 0845 373 3366 Website: www.ukna.org
NA is a non-profit Fellowship of men and women for whom drugs had become a major problem. We are recovering addicts who meet regularly to help each other stay clean. The only requirement for membership is the desire to stop using.
